Three young(ish) pastors tackle foundational questions about God, life, and why what Christians believe matters.

What does it mean to “be saved?” How does Jesus save? In this episode of The Podechesis Podcast, the guys start a conversation on salvation as referenced in The Faith Once Delivered document published by the John Wesley Institute. more
